After Helping an Elderly Man and His Dog with Groceries, I Was Stunned by What Followed

At seven months pregnant, with little money and a fragile grip on stability, I encountered an elderly man in the grocery store. He stood at the checkout, meticulously counting worn dollar bills, prioritizing cans of dog food for his small terrier, Pippin, over his own needs. A pang of empathy struck me, and despite having only $20 to my name, I stepped forward and covered the cost of his entire grocery cart.

The man, Graham, offered a quiet thank you, sharing that Pippin was his sole companion. I assumed our brief connection ended there. The following morning, however, I opened my front door and stopped in my tracks. A crate brimming with groceries, baby essentials, and diapers awaited me on the porch. Beyond it, parked at the curb, gleamed a silver car adorned with a bow. Tucked inside an envelope was a heartfelt note from Graham.

In his letter, he revealed that after losing his wife, he had carried on her tradition of dressing modestly to gauge whether kindness still thrived in the world. My gesture, he wrote, affirmed her enduring belief in humanity’s goodness. The car, the supplies, and a prepaid grocery account were his way of expressing gratitude and passing kindness forward.

Each time I drive that car or spot Graham and Pippin in the store, I’m reminded that a single act of compassion can ripple outward, touching two lives in profound and unexpected ways.
